Regulatory Landscape, Certifications, and Compliance Timelines:

  • Compliance with ISO, JEDEC, and industry-specific standards is mandatory for global market access.
  • Automotive and aerospace sectors require adherence to IATF 16949 and AS9100 standards.
  • Certification processes typically span 6-12 months, influencing time-to-market strategies.

Technological Innovations and Product Launches:

  • Introduction of ultra-low power, high-frequency oscillators tailored for IoT and wearable devices.
  • Development of temperature-compensated and oven-controlled crystal oscillators (TCXOs and OCXOs) for precision applications.
  • Integration of MEMS-based oscillators as alternatives to traditional quartz components, offering miniaturization and robustness.
